Beware of People Search Frauds

Conducting a background check can be helpful, but stay vigilant for potential scams. Fraudsters often exploit these services to swindle unsuspecting individuals. Pay attention to key signals:

  • Unrealistic promises: If a service promises to find any information, it's likely a warning sign.
  • Hidden fees: Legitimate services should be clear about their pricing. Avoid platforms that are ambiguous about how much you'll spend.
  • High-pressure sales: Cons artists typically use coercion to get you to act quickly. Think carefully before providing any details.
  • Unprofessional appearance: A well-designed website should look professional. Be cautious if you encounter a site that appears amateurish.

If you encounter any of these warning signs, discontinue using the platform. Protect yourself by conducting thorough research before providing data to any investigative tool.
